Ingredients
- ½ cup butter, softened
- ½ tsp vanilla extract
- 1 egg
- ¼ cup sugar
- ½ cup packed brown sugar
- 1 ½ cup all purpose flour
- ¾ tsp baking soda
- ¼ tsp baking powder
- ½ cup old fashioned oats
- ½ cup rice krispies
- ½ cup white chocolate chips (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F.
- In a large mixing bowl, using an electric mixer, cream together the butter, vanilla extract, and egg.
- In a separate bowl, combine sugar, brown sugar, flour, baking soda, baking powder, and oats. Stir until fully combined and then add to the butter mixture.
- Blend together until fully mixed. Fold in the Rice Krispies & white chocolate chips if using.
- Using a cookie scoop, scoop rounded balls of dough onto a silicone or parchment-lined baking sheet.
- Bake for 10-12 minutes. Allow to cool 1 minute on the baking sheet and then transfer to a cooling rack to completely cool.
